A vivid red emperor shrimp sits beside the mantle of a Spanish dancer nudibranch. The symbiosis between these two species is common β€” most Spanish dancers live together with this shrimp species.

A beautiful symbiosis between an emperor shrimp and a Risbecia nudibranch. The small crustacean with its characteristic red-and-white body and striking white claws has chosen the nudibranch as its habitat β€” a frequently observed behaviour.
